Synopsis
Poems for young readers chosen by david powell. introduced by edmund blunden. illustrated by john o'connor.
Item Description
FIRST EDITION. 8vo. 8.75 x 5.5 inches. 96 pp. Bound in original brown cloth, gilt, in unclipped pictorial dust wrapper, which is slightly browned along top edge. Slight foxing of fore edge; otherwise a very good clean copy. Illustrated by text figure vignettes, including title page vignette. Decorated by publisher's device on verso of title. Nature and pastoral poems of John Clare (1797-1864), selected for young readers by John Powell, who was Reference Librarian at Northampton Public Library, and in charge of the Clare Collection there. The selection is introduced by the poet, Edmund Blunden (1896-1974), an editor of, and authority on, Clare. Illustrated by the artist and wood engraver John O'Connor (1912-2004).
